Kerosene oil rises up in a wick of a lantern because of
PhysicsMechanical Properties of FluidsVITEEEVITEEE 2017
Options:
  • A diffusion of the oil through the wick
  • B capillary action
  • C buoyant force of air
  • D the gravitational pull of the wick
Solution:
2318 Upvotes Verified Answer
The correct answer is: capillary action
Kerosene oil rises up in wick of a lantern because of capillary action. If the surface tension of oil is zero, then it will not rise, so oil rises up in a wick of a lantern due to surface tension.
